Women with PCOS Deserve Better: Recognition, Research, and Real NHS Support Now
We urge the Government & NHS England to recognise PCOS as a long-term condition, end diagnosis delays, train doctors, provide joined-up care, fair fertility access, reinstated treatments, funded research, licensed medicines, and free/subsidised support. Women deserve real NHS care.
PCOS affects 1 in 10 women in the UK yet remains overlooked. Women are dismissed with “just lose weight,” offered only the pill, or denied fertility care due to BMI, though PCOS itself causes weight gain. This is discriminatory. PCOS raises risks of diabetes, high blood pressure, liver disease, infertility, anxiety and depression. I was diagnosed at 15, given no follow-up, and now live with multiple related conditions. Women with PCOS deserve recognition, fair care and real NHS support
